Hi, recently the volume rocker on my legend started behaving strangely. When I press it, it only shows the Media volume dialog, even though I am not playing back anything and don't have any media player running. This means I cannot control ringer volume/quiet/vibrate settings by using the rocker. Having to set this through Sound and Display settings or the power button is pretty annoying. Any idea how to fix this? Thanks

Perhaps try downloading a Task Killer application, I'd recommend "Advanced Task Killer" from the market, and look to see if you have any music/game/whatever apps which may affect the volume rocker and kill the process. That way you can ensure that it IS actually a weird fault/bug, and not a background app interfering.

I had the same problem some time ago but somehow I managed to fix it. As far as I remember I started the FM Radio and pulled out the headphones a few times, until the volume rocker suddenly behaved normally again. One of a bit too many software bugs :)
